In 2025, South Camden Theatre Company will present the NJ premiere of my rueful, hopeful comedy HOLLYWOOD, NEBRASKA. It doesn't have political rage or cultural upheaval on its mind. It's about two middle-aged actresses who return to their hometown to face the ache and joy of homecoming. Link in bio.
